The 24th Day  


Tony Piccirillo
États-Unis 2004 35mm 92min. english o.v.

What would you do if you found out that a long ago one-night stand has just destroyed your world? In this taut psychological thriller, Tom (Scott Speedman, Duets, Felicity) is a married man with a secret taste for guys that he only indulged once – and when he finds out he is HIV-positive, he is determined to exact vengeance on the man he believes gave it to him. What began as a sexy dalliance escalates into a nightmarish odyssey with Tom holding Dan (James Marsden, X-Men, Ally McBeal) hostage. Piccirillo makes a stunning directorial debut, adapting his award-winning play into a searing and suspenseful story of a strained power play between captor and captive. Speedman and Marsden also do career-transforming turns in this chilling film that raises prickly ethical issues as it lurches to its painful conclusion, giving the audience something to think about long after the lights come up. – AB
